Maintaining Marble Floors

Among natural stone, Marble has the most diverse colors and veins which make it one of the most used materials for flooring. Combined with the overall interior, Marble flooring effectively contribute the elegance, sophistication and durability to each building. The proper use and maintenance of Marble stone play an important role to maintain the beauty of the Marble floor.

Daily Care

This is the easiest way with the lowest cost to maintain the beauty of the marble floor. Carpet should be put in the entrance to limit dust and sand from outside to scratch the surface of Marble floors. Clean the floor regularly with a clean towel and dedicated products for natural stone or a neutral cleaner. Quickly clean water, the fluid (oil, grease, coffee, tea, etc.) to minimize their absorption into the stone.

Never attempt to remove stains or deposits by scraping, scouring, or indiscriminately applying bleaching agents, liquid marble cleaners, or other harsh chemicals. Damage such as rust stains may not appear until months later. In addition, all acids are potentially harmful to marble surfaces.

Periodic Professional Maintenance

In addition to daily care, depending on the condition of the floor and the quality requirement of the finishing surface, Marble flooring should be monthly or quarterly maintained by professional companies. Using specialized products and equipment, professional companies can serve comprehensive cleaning, removing stains, dirt, polishing or honing. Periodic Professional maintenance also helps detect and timely solve problems such as the stains, dirt, scratches, water absorption…
